Cosimo Tura
Cosimo Tura (1430–1495) was a painter, carpets designer and court painter.
Also recorded as Il Cosmè; Cosmè Tura; Cosme Tura; Cosme da Ferrara; Da Ferrara Tura; Il Cosme.
Overview
The authority record associates the name with Quattrocento. Places of work recorded in the authority include Ferrara. Works named in the authority record include A Muse (Calliope?), Christ Crucified, The Trial of Saint Maurelius and Saint John the Evangelist in Patmos.
